What to Expect (Job Responsibilities):
- Follow up on unpaid and underpaid claims to meet or exceed collection targets and minimize write-offs
- Research claim denials and correct/reprocess claims for timely payment
- Identify root causes of denial trends and recommend solutions to prevent future denials
- Participate in team meetings to share denial trends and enhance front-end claim edits
- Meet established productivity and quality metrics for the accounts receivable department
What is Required (Qualifications):
- High School Graduate/GED required; Technical School/2 Years College/Associates Degree preferred
- Minimum of 1-3 years of experience in healthcare revenue cycle
- Knowledge of healthcare billing, CPT/ICD-10 coding, and various insurance claim requirements
- Strong organizational skills, attention to detail, and problem-solving abilities
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office and strong computer literacy skills
